U.S. Secretary of State Marco Rubio visited the Western Wall with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u on Sunday (September 14) after arriving to discuss the future of the conflict with the Palestinians as Israel plans to seize the city of Gaza.

Rubio and Netanyahu touched and placed written notes in the Western Wall, a sacred site in Judaism.

Israeli forces destroyed at least 30 residential buildings in Gaza City and forced thousands of people from their homes, Palestinian officials said on Sunday.

The group's political leadership, which has engaged in on-and-off negotiations on a possible ceasefire and hostage release deal, was targeted by Israel in an airstrike in Doha on Tuesday (September 9) in an attack that drew widespread condemnation.

U.S. officials described Tuesday's strike on the territory of a close U.S. ally as a unilateral escalation that did not serve American or Israeli interests.
